1.Potassium-40 decays by three pathways: β decay, positron emission, and electron capture.

Write a balanced equation for the positron emission process.

2.The concentration of NaCl in red blood cells is approximately 598.00 ppm. For a NaCl solution, assume the solution completely dissociates giving a van ’t Hoff factor of 2. Calculate the osmotic pressure of this solution at body temperature (37°C).
